YOGURT PARFAIT WITH FRESH FRUIT & CHIA SEEDS 

I love to start off my mornings with a creamy yogurt parfait topped with superfoods. It's nutritious, light, & energizing with fresh fruit, chia & flax seeds, dark chocolate chips, & goji berries.

A great tip for yogurt parfaits is to soak your nuts for 5 mins so the nuts remain a crunchy texture, but aren't so difficult to eat. You can use any fruits & nuts you have on hand; the possibilities are endless.

INGREDIENTS

1 cup strawberry yogurt (or greek yogurt)
1 chopped banana
1 peach
4 strawberries
2 tbsp blueberries
2 tbsp raspberries
2 tbsp granola
2 tbsp pecans
2 tbsp goji berries (optional)
2 tbsp chia seeds
2 tbsp flax seeds
2 tbsp dark chocolate chips

METHOD

Keep yogurt in the freezer to cool for 10-15 mins. While then, chop your fruit into smaller pieces.

Soak the pecans into lukewarm water.

Place yogurt in bowl, top with chopped fruit, granola, chia & flax seeds, & dark chocolate chips.

GOING NUTS : CHIA BOWL WITH FRESH FRUIT & NUTS

Almond milk is a great substitute for milk. It is cholesterol & lactose free and comes in a variety of flavours including vanilla and chocolate. 

Chia pudding made with almond milk is the perfect healthy sugar-free dessert. You can even add flavours into the chia pudding such as vanilla whey protein powder, coconut or nut butter. The possibilities are endless. 



INGREDIENTS

1 cup almond milk
2 tbsp chia seeds
2 tbsp flax seeds (optional)
1 tsp sliced almonds
1 tsp goji berries
1 tsp pecans
1/2 peach, banana, apricot
1 handful blueberries & raspberries



METHOD

In a bowl, combine almond milk, chia seeds & flax seeds. Refrigerate for 4-5 hours. until it is pudding consistency. Stir occasionally. 

Pour into bowl & top with fresh fruit & toppings of your choice.
